Start early in preparing yourself for a home loan application. If you want a mortgage, get your finances in order right away. You should have a healthy savings account and any debt that you have must be manageable. If you put these things off too long, you could face a denial letter.
While you wait for a pre-approved mortgage, do not do tons of shopping. Lenders generally check your credit a couple of days prior to the loan closing. If there are significant changes to your credit, lenders may deny your loan. Save the spending for later, after the mortgage is finalized.
Your mortgage loan is at risk of rejection if the are major changes to your finances. Wait until you’re securely employed before applying for a home mortgage. Do not change job while you are in the process of obtaining your mortgage, either.
If you decide on a mortgage, be sure you’ve got good credit. Lenders carefully scrutinize credit histories to ascertain good risks. If you’ve got bad credit, do what you must to repair it so that you avoid having the application denied.

If you’re having trouble paying off your mortgage, get help. Think about getting financial counseling if you are having problems making payments. There are many private and public credit counseling groups available. By using HUD approved counselors, your chances of going into foreclosure are lower. To find a counselor in your area, check the HUD website or call them yourself.

If you want an easy approval, go for a balloon mortgage. These loans offer a short term with the balance owed at the end of the loan. These loans are risky, since interest rates can escalate rapidly.
An ARM, otherwise known as adjustable rate mortgage does not end when the loan terms end. The rate is sometimes adjusted, however. This means the mortgage could have a higher interest rate.

Approval Letter
Sellers know you are truly motivated to buy when you are prepared with a letter indicating you are approved for a home loan. It demonstrates that your financial information has been evaluated and you have been approved. Although you must make sure that your offer meets the terms of the approval letter. If your approval letter states a higher amount, the seller will try to hold our for a higher selling price.
